Transaction d9735291b39c02d3e364ed70e3f42aaa4b28c106d5fb0e4f578aba2227edea8c
1 Input
1 Output
-
d9735291b39c02d3e364ed70e3f42aaa4b28c106d5fb0e4f578aba2227edea8c:0
- value
- 606007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8977bf7fe67ad24476141bcfd6fb8c226a9accef OP_EQUAL
- address
- 3EDsx4hVECC6QYKVKK31n4EnXMigeJ51RN